Well personally this brings up something I hope is in FFXV: mulitple different ways/options to get stronger and ways to manipulate the battle system . Sort of like FF8's item conversion system/magic junction system but easier to understand and utilize. Grinding is so much better when it's done like FF7 and FF8. In those games there are multiple different things you can do to get stronger inside the battle system besides just killing monsters. Ultimately you'd have to kill the monsters at the end but you could morph them into items, raiser their levels so you can get higher EXP points defeating them, steal from them, learn their abilities, control them to use their abilities on you; in FFX you could capture enemies with specific weapons and if you overkilled enemies you were given better rewards. This is the kind of stuff that needs to be in FFXV and every FF from here on spinoff or not.
